Maryland Statutes

§ 4-101

Maryland·Article gel Election Law·Title 4
Except as to a matter of compelling State interest, if any provision of this title relating to party governance conflicts with the constitution and bylaws of a political party, the constitution and bylaws shall apply to the extent of the conflict.
